Earlier, SPPS team at the Semi Finals trounced the School of Engineering and Information Technology (SKTM) with a score of 8-2, which was then followed by SPE team with their win over SPS with a score of 11-8. In the deciding match for the third placing saw SKTM beat SPS with an aggregate of 9-3.
At the initial competition which involved a league match saw SPPS taking the top spot in the Group A whilst SKTM took the top spot for Group B and SPE for Group C. The three groups had won all competitions in their respective groupings.
Sports Science lecturer, Dr Mohamad Nizam Nazarudin expressed his satisfaction and felt proud of his team’s success in retaining the champion title every year, at the same time urged other teams to improve their play.
The closing and prize presentation was done by the Deputy Vice-Chancellor of Student Affairs and Alumni UMS, Assoc. Prof. Datuk Dr. Hj. Kasim Hj. Md. Mansur. The championship which was participated by nine teams among others aimed at encouraging students to make sports as a culture and healthy lifestyle in line with academic achievement in producing healthy students. – FL
